Senior React Developer

Department: Engineering Location: Seattle, WA (Greater Seattle Area) Type: Full Time

About AIM

AIM Intelligent Machines is transforming the physical foundation of civilization—everything humanity depends on is mined, dug, or grown. We build autonomous heavy equipment (bulldozers, loaders, excavators), enabling fleets powered by AI to operate continuously, safely, and efficiently in the world’s harshest environments. Built by leading minds from industries like mining, construction, Waymo, SpaceX, Google, and Tesla, AIM’s platform supports production mines, large-scale infrastructure projects, and defense operations. We are backed by top-tier investors including General Catalyst, Khosla Ventures, Elad Gil, Human Capital, Ironspring Ventures, Mantis, and DCVC.

About the Role

The user interface is where humans interact with autonomy. As a Senior React Developer, you'll design and build robust web applications powering AIM’s autonomous fleet: a safety-critical Operator UI, a multi-tenant customer portal, and the design system underpinning both.

You write clean, maintainable TypeScript and React, and bring equal rigor to UI correctness, safety, reliability, and user experience. You understand the difference between a UI that looks correct and one that is truly reliable—even under adverse conditions like bright sunlight or gloved operation on a worksite. You'll thrive in a team that prizes clarity, customer focus, and engineering excellence.

Responsibilities

  • Architect and build a robust design system, including setting the direction for components, accessibility, theming, versioning, and migration tooling

  • Own the developer experience for all engineers leveraging the design system

  • Develop the Operator UI, including:

  • Implementing live 3D scenes using Three.js, React Three Fiber, and Drei (rendering point clouds, geofences, machine overlays)

  • Designing state machines (XState), validation, and observability for safety-critical flows

  • Building teleop controls and integrating live video streaming

  • Shape the administration portal as a true SaaS product, focusing on:

  • Multi-tenant authorization, internationalization, and real-time data architecture

  • Designing customer-facing experiences meeting B2B software standards

  • Deliver production-ready, high-quality TypeScript using modern frontend engineering best practices

  • Lead code reviews, design reviews, and architectural discussions

  • Collaborate with field deployment engineers to gather real-world feedback and improve the codebase

Qualifications

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Design, HCI, or equivalent hands-on experience

  • 5+ years of professional software engineering experience delivering production frontend systems

  • Deep expertise with TypeScript and React (modern patterns like hooks, suspense, and concurrent rendering)

  • Familiarity with frontend tools: Vite, npm/pnpm workspaces, Storybook, Vitest, Cypress, Testing Library

  • Strong debugging skills (browser devtools, logs, telemetry, tracing)

  • Proven track record of delivering high-quality software individually and across teams

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with 3D web graphics: Three.js, React Three Fiber, WebGL, or point cloud rendering

  • Experience with real-time data and binary serialization (Protocol Buffers, gRPC-web, WebSockets)

  • Exposure to safety-critical or industrial UI in sectors like robotics, automotive, aerospace, medical, or defense

  • Experience with state machines (XState), TanStack Router/Query, Zustand, Tailwind CSS, Floating UI, or multi-tenant SaaS authorization (ReBAC/ABAC)

What We Offer

  • High-impact ownership across our frontend stack and global deployments

  • Collaboration with world-class engineers in software, autonomy, hardware, and robotics

  • Competitive compensation, equity, medical/dental/vision, 401(k), and life insurance

  • Travel opportunities to customer jobsites across the U.S., Australia, Europe, Africa, South America, and beyond

  • Strong onsite collaboration at AIM offices, labs, and testing grounds in the Greater Seattle area
